So I hoping to have a Brittany pup by this coming spring and I am looking for training books. I just ordered The Training and Care of the Versatile Hunting Dog by Winterhelt and Bailey from amazon. Has anyone read or used this book? Any other recommendations for pointer training books?
 
Get the NAVHDA(North American Versitile Hunting Dog Association) training Manual. I trained my Viszla with it and it worked out quite well. Next year I'll be using it again when I get my Deutsch Drahtaar.
 
There's a defunct club, the American Hunting Dog Club (ahdc.org), that went through considerable effort to publish a manual for their members. It is still available and is an excellent reference. The owner of vom Meadowlakes kennel put me onto it.

I will likely be getting a vom Willowrock drahthaar early next year.
 
I purchased the Perfect Start/ Perfect Finish DVD's and they are amazing training videos for pointers. All the dogs video'd have zero training and you really see detailed progression. They arent cheap at about $130 US but really worth it if you want to train yourself.
